我想从Chat表中计算值:IDREASON_IDDEPARTMENT_ID14612461350145025100161002那些存在于Reason表中:IDREASON_NAME46Reason150Reason2100Reason3DEPARTMENT_ID=1,我想要这样的结果:ID46ID50ID100211我该怎么做? 最佳答案 您可以尝试以下方法:set@sql=null;selectgroup_concat(distinctconcat('sum(r.id=',r.id,')asID',r.id))into@sqlfr
我有这两列:1.座位已经坐满了。seat_id是auto_increment。seat_idseattype111221331472......2。日期座位iddate_bookedseat_iduser_id12016-5-124222016-5-1453........我想从给定的类型和给定的日期中选择座位。例如,如果类型是2,日期是2016-5-12。我想选择除7以外的所有类型2的座位。因为seat_id4,即座位7在2016年5月12日已经存在我尝试了什么:$type=$_POST['type'];$flightdate=$_POST['flightdate'];$sql="S
我想使用googleapps脚本来同步MySQL和google表格,以便有人可以编辑google表格,它会更新相应的MySQL表格。我已连接MySQL和google表格,以便我可以在返回MySQL表的google应用程序脚本中运行查询(包括更新查询)。只是不是相反。 最佳答案 我遇到过与您类似的问题,我得到了答案hereonstackoverflow,希望对您也有帮助。它提供了一些解决方案:GoogleAppsScript、Zapier、Kloud、Blockspring和Actiondesk。
我有一个应用程序需要支持多语言界面,确切地说是五种语言。对于接口(interface)的主要部分,可以使用标准ResourceBundle方法来处理。但是,数据库包含大量表格,其元素包含人类可读的名称、描述、摘要等。需要能够以所有五种语言输入每一项。虽然我想我可以简单地在每个表上设置字段,例如NameLang1NameLang2...我觉得在编写代表每个表的bean时,这会导致大量基本相同的代码。从纯面向对象的角度来看,解决方案非常简单。每个类都有一个Text对象,其中包含每种语言的相关文本。这更有用,因为只有一种语言是强制性的,其他语言有回退规则(例如,如果语言4缺少返回语言2,返回
我有一个包含所有销售额的表格,定义如下:mysql>describesaledata;+-------------------+---------------------+------+-----+---------+-------+|Field|Type|Null|Key|Default|Extra|+-------------------+---------------------+------+-----+---------+-------+|SaleDate|datetime|NO||NULL|||StoreID|bigint(20)unsigned|NO||NULL|||Qu
有没有什么办法可以通过mysql中的View向多个表中插入数据? 最佳答案 MySQLReferenceManual对可更新的View是这样说的:Someviewsareupdatable.Thatis,youcanusetheminstatementssuchasUPDATE,DELETE,orINSERTtoupdatethecontentsoftheunderlyingtable.Foraviewtobeupdatable,theremustbeaone-to-onerelationshipbetweentherowsinth
我希望对此有所了解。我有一个表格,其中包含名字、姓氏、城市、州和电子邮件地址。此表单使用jquery验证插件和表单插件。我想检查电子邮件是否已经存在...如果是,则吐出一条消息,告诉他们它们已经存在。这就是我的update.php脚本,如果用于将名称添加到mysql数据库,则格式如下:Thankyouforaddingyourinfo";mysql_close($con);?> 最佳答案 你应该createauniqueindex在电子邮件列上,那么如果您尝试插入同一封电子邮件两次,插入将失败。CREATEUNIQUEINDEXux
这就是桌子的样子。代码:SubWordTableTester()DimCurrentTableAstableDimwdDocAsDocumentDimRwAsLong,colAsLongDimwdFileNamewdFileName=Application.GetOpenFilename("Wordfiles(*.docx),*.docx",,"Pleasechooseafilecontainingrequirementstobeimported")IfwdFileName=FalseThenExitSub'(usercancelledimportfilebrowser)SetwdDoc=Ge
我在MySQL中有一个MEMORY表用于实时聊天(也许这不是最好的表类型?),并且每晚删除行以保持聊天日志的可管理性导致表中的开销。但是,由于您不能在MEMORY表上运行OPTIMIZE,您如何摆脱开销(showtablestatus中的Data_free)? 最佳答案 howdoyougetridoftheoverhead?您可以强制使用MEMORY/HEAP存储引擎的表通过更改它来恢复从已删除行中丢失的剩余空间,但不更改任何内容。例如ALTERTABLEmy_tableENGINE=MEMORY;它将重新写入表格。用docume
我需要从表中获取下一个ID(auto_increment)。我可以只使用SELECT*fromtableORDERBYidDESCLIMIT1;例如我得到50。但如果我们从表中删除两项,我将得到48,但更正一项将是51。即使我们从表中删除了某些内容,如何获得正确的值? 最佳答案 您只能使用SHOWTABLESTATUSLIKE'tablename'来获取auto_increment值。一个更简单的解决方案可能是:SELECTMAX(id)+1FROMtable,但如果最后一个条目被删除,这将是错误的。